Como corrigir problemas de servidor Linux no Multilogin X
Você está com problemas para iniciar perfis de navegador em um servidor Linux? Está tendo dificuldades para obter um número de porta após uma resposta bem-sucedida de API? Recebe um erro ao tentar habilitar o modo de automação e o modo headless? Este artigo vai te ajudar!
Iniciar perfis manualmente
Mantenha o aplicativo para desktop aberto (ou conecte o agente se estiver usando a interface web).
- Terminal de lançamento
- Execute o seguinte comando (substitua
folder_ideprofile_id, respectivamente):curl -X GET https://localhost:45000/api/v2/profile/f/<folder_id>/p/<profile_id>/start - Verifique se o perfil foi iniciado com sucesso
Localizar e analisar registros do agente
- Acesse um dos seguintes diretórios:
/opt/usr/mlx//home/%username%/mlx/logs
- Procure pelos
launcher_<date>.logeagent_<date>.log
Investigar erros de SSL/TLS
- Verifique se há erros de "MAC de registro inválido" nos logs:
SSL: DECRYPTION_FAILED_OR_BAD_RECORD_MAC - Certifique-se de que a configuração OpenSSL do servidor Linux esteja correta.
Leia mais detalhes sobre a configuração do OpenSSL aqui: Open SSL - Ubuntu Server documentation
Comparar o comportamento API e da interface do usuário
- Se o lançamento pela interface do usuário funcionar, mas API falhar, verifique os parâmetros API e as configurações da interface do usuário (eles devem ser iguais).
- Faça o teste manualmente usando o mesmo ID de perfil e configurações via
curl
Para obter informações sobre o comando curl, consulte o capítulo "Iniciar perfis manualmente" e as informações sobre o endpoint GET Start Browser Profile em nossa documentação de API.
Verifique a configuração do ambiente Linux
- Certifique-se de que o Xvfb esteja instalado e configurado corretamente para o modo headless. Consulte os seguintes artigos para obter mais detalhes:
- Confirme se o agente ou aplicativo Multilogin X está em execução e acessível pela porta correta (consulte a etapa no seguinte artigo: Como corrigir problemas de conexão do agente).
Nada funciona?
Se o problema persistir, envie-nos seus arquivos de registro e investigaremos o caso mais a fundo.
- Recrie o problema ou aguarde até que a mensagem de erro apareça.
- Arquive a pasta de registros encontrada neste local:
/home/%username%/mlx - Envie um e-mail para [email protected] com as seguintes informações:
- Uma descrição clara do problema
- A pasta de registros arquivados está anexada.
Este artigo inclui links de terceiros que não endossamos oficialmente.